This is a small book filled with short stories about the Herdmans - the worst family in town. Beth's class has been tasked with thinking of one positive characteristic about each person in their class by the end of the year, a task she finds impossible with Imogene Herdman in your class. This book contains vignettes of Beth's struggles throughout the school year to notice Imogene's good side. Does burying a dead snake that you brought to school count as thoughtful? Does standing for the pledge of allegiance every morning count as patriotic? Beth will keep thinking...
This was a fun book with cute characters. It definitely makes you think about finding the best in everyone and highlighting peoples' attributes instead of their flaws.
